Bosch BP893 Quiet...

Regular price $52.79 $105.59

Bosch BSD1414 Sev...

Regular price $50.39 $100.79

Bosch BSD1411 Sev...

Regular price $43.19 $86.39

Bosch BSD1096 Sev...

Regular price $46.79 $93.59

Bosch BSD1094 Sev...

Regular price $52.79 $105.59

Bosch BSD1084 Sev...

Regular price $52.79 $105.59

Bosch BSD1377 Sev...

Regular price $50.39 $100.79

Bosch BSD1194 Sev...

Regular price $55.19 $110.39

Bosch BSD1363 Sev...

Regular price $58.79 $117.59

Bosch BSD1404 Sev...

Regular price $65.99 $131.99

Bosch BSD1400 Sev...

Regular price $61.19 $122.39

Bosch BSD1328 Sev...

Regular price $57.59 $115.19